Syria-Lebanon-Iran
IDF blows up Hizbullah bunker near border
2006-08-27
The IDF has blown up a Hizbullah bunker, uncovered 400 meters from the northern border near Rosh Hanikra.

Deputy Commander of the Golani Brigade, Lieutenant General Gasam Alian, said that "this is a bunker that sprawls on the ground two kilometers with shooting positions of molded concrete." He added that the bunker was advanced and connected to telephone lines. (Hanan Greenberg)
